Developer’s Description

Type in Khmer on your iOS device.
Khmer Keyboard uniquely designed for iPhone and iPad. Adjustable text size. Share/Post Directly from the app via: Email, Message, Facebook (iOS 6.0+), Twitter (iOS 6.0+). Copy to clipboard and paste in any other app. Paragraph formatting including alignment, line spacing, margins, indenting, bullets and numbering. Automatically saves the text when you quit the app. Youtube search on your native language. IOS 6 and IOS 7 keyboard style. Keyboard landscape mode. Store you text and edit them. Supports Retina displays, iPhone 5.
